Visiting Christ the Redeemer: Tips for an Unforgettable Experience

Visiting Christ the Redeemer, one of the New Seven Wonders of the World, is an unforgettable experience that attracts millions of tourists each year. To make the most of your visit, here are some essential tips to consider.

Plan Your Visit in Advance

One of the most important aspects of visiting Christ the Redeemer is planning ahead. The statue is located on Corcovado Mountain in Tijuca National Park, and it can get very crowded, especially during peak tourist seasons. Consider booking your tickets online well in advance to avoid long lines at the ticket booth.

Choose the Right Time

The best time to visit Christ the Redeemer is early in the morning or late in the afternoon. These times not only offer cooler temperatures but also provide the best lighting for photographs. Additionally, visiting during off-peak seasons, typically during the rainy months of November to March, can enhance your experience by avoiding crowds.

Getting There

There are several ways to reach Christ the Redeemer. The most popular options include the cog train, van services, or hiking. The cog train offers a scenic journey through the jungle and is a favored choice among tourists. If you’re feeling adventurous, hiking through the lush rainforest trails can also be a rewarding experience.

Explore Surrounding Areas

Allow some time to explore the surrounding areas after visiting the statue. The views from the top of Corcovado Mountain offer stunning perspectives of Sugarloaf Mountain, Guanabara Bay, and the entire city of Rio de Janeiro. Enjoying these vistas can enhance your experience significantly.
